Open scheduling infrastructure that gives any AI agent reliable calendar scheduling over MCP, A2A, and REST, with atomic booking and deterministic time logic.

Temporal Cortex is open scheduling infrastructure that gives any AI agent reliable scheduling across calendars. It provides 18 tools across 5 layers over MCP, A2A, and REST protocols, with deterministic temporal computation from its Truth Engine, cross provider availability merging, and atomic booking using a two phase commit to prevent double bookings. It connects Google Calendar, Outlook, and iCloud and integrates with agent frameworks such as LangGraph, CrewAI, and the OpenAI Agents SDK. The managed platform adds multi agent coordination with distributed locking, usage metering and a dashboard, caller based booking policies, and a content firewall that detects prompt injection and strips zero width Unicode. Tool responses are returned in a token optimized format to reduce agent token costs. Temporal Cortex ships an open source core under permissive licensing with a free managed platform, and its Agent Skills work across Claude, Cursor, and more than 20 other agent platforms.

Capability coverage

6.5 / 14 capabilities · 46%

Integrations & Tool CallingConnects Google, Outlook, and iCloud calendars, exposes 18 tools, and integrates with LangGraph, CrewAI, and the OpenAI Agents SDK (temporal-cortex.com, github.com). Full
Workflow OrchestrationRoutes a scheduling workflow across 5 layers from time resolution to availability to booking, with multi agent coordination, though orchestration is scheduling specific (github.com, temporal-cortex.com). Partial
Knowledge Grounding & RAGNot a knowledge grounding or RAG product (temporal-cortex.com). Unable to verify
Human Oversight & GuardrailsCaller based policies enforce booking rules per agent such as max duration and allowed hours; these are guardrails rather than human approval loops (github.com). Partial
Security, Identity & GovernanceA content firewall detects prompt injection and strips zero width Unicode, and OAuth token refresh is handled server side; no SOC 2 or enterprise identity is documented (github.com). Partial
Observability & AuditabilityA usage dashboard and metering track tool calls per agent and team, connected calendars, and billing (github.com). Full
Memory & State PersistenceDistributed locking is transient coordination to prevent double bookings, not agent memory or state persistence (github.com). Unable to verify
Deployment & Data ResidencyShips an open source self host server with zero infrastructure alongside a free managed platform (temporal-cortex.com, github.com). Full
Prebuilt Agents / Templates / PacksAgent Skills and focused sub skills provide prebuilt scheduling capabilities across more than 20 agent platforms (github.com). Partial
Triggers & Channel CoverageSupports autonomous scheduling over MCP, A2A, REST, and email, plus an Open Scheduling network for publicly queryable availability (github.com, temporal-cortex.com). Partial
Model Flexibility & RoutingModel agnostic infrastructure that works with any agent but does not itself route or select models (temporal-cortex.com). Unable to verify
APIs / SDKs / MCP ExtensibilityExposes an MCP server, A2A, a REST API, an npm package, and framework SDK integrations (github.com, temporal-cortex.com). Full
Testing, Debugging & OptimizationBenchmarks are published as marketing content; no user facing testing or evaluation tooling is documented (temporal-cortex.com). Unable to verify
Browser / Computer-useBrowser is listed as a delivery protocol, not browser automation or computer use (github.com). Unable to verify

Pricing

Free. Temporal Cortex ships an open source core for self hosting and a free managed platform; no paid tier is publicly priced.

Usage metering on the managed platform tracks tool calls per agent and team; no published rate.

Public — partialLow variable costFree tier

Included quota

Open source is unlimited when self hosted; the managed platform is currently free.

Cost watchouts

Usage metering and billing infrastructure exist on the managed platform, so paid usage tiers may be introduced; self hosting adds standard infrastructure and OAuth app maintenance.

Variable cost rationale

The core is deterministic computation rather than model inference, self hosting adds only minor infrastructure, and the managed platform is currently free, so cost does not scale materially with usage today.
